GENERAL INFORMATION: PACE Education provides high quality early childhood education with case management support services from birth to five years of age for economically disadvantaged families. In addition to early childhood education, the program also provides case management support to assist with health, nutrition, mental health, disabilities, and parent empowerment and involvement services. This program is funded and operated under Head Start, Early Head Start, State Preschool guidelines and regulations. PACE Education includes Head Start & Early Head Start Center-Based Program that operates 16 school sites enrolling children ages 18 months through age 5 at local preschool sites, including a Home-Based program serving enrolled children, ages 0-3 years and pregnant women. These services are provided in the metro Los Angeles area through Santa Monica and South Bay communities (Gardena, Torrance, Hawthorne, and Lawndale). BASIC FUNCTION: The EHS Parent Educator provides case management support services and appropriate child development activities to infants, toddlers, pregnant mothers, and their families. The primary role of the EHS Parent Educator is to establish a partnership with parents to develop and implement positive early childhood experiences for their children. CHARACTERISTIC D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ES: Manage a full caseload, up to 12 families, conducting weekly, 1.5-hour Home Visits with parents and their enrolled child(ren): Work with parents to strengthen the family�s knowledge of child development, including helping parents understand how children grow and learn. Work with pregnant mothers and other expectant family members to help support a healthy pregnancy through the birth of their newborn. Plan and conduct educational activities with parents to meet the child�s intellectual, physical, emotional, and social needs. Work with parents to motivate and support to complete weekly home visits, up to 85% attendance, and participate in recruitment of children as indicated in the ERSEA plan to maintain a full caseload. Provides respectful customer service and collaboration with parents, children, community representatives /members, and all PACE staff on a daily basis. Manage educational services: Develop and effectively implement an individualized weekly home-based educational plan using a research-based curriculum that will support and strengthen a positive relationship between parent and child, promoting the parent as the child�s first teacher. Help parents set up an environment that is safe, developmentally appropriate, and conducive for learning. Provide learning and developmental and screenings for infants and toddlers (including DRDP-2015 IT, ASQ-3, ASQ:SE-2, etc.) for parents to complete, and support, and follow through with the developmental screening of infants� and toddlers� motor, language, social, cognitive, perceptual, and emotional skills. Document child observations weekly during home visits and socializations to manage developmental strengths and needs over a period of time across different settings. Help parents understand early child development and milestones, and include parents in managing and reporting their child�s developmental progress. Maintain an open, friendly, and cooperative relationship with each child�s family; encourage parental involvement in the program; promote parent-child bonding and nurturing parent-child relationships.
